  • Advanced Geographic Information Systems (GIS)

Geographic Information Systems (GIS) are powerful tools that help in mapping and analyzing spatial data. These systems allow us to visualize, interpret, and understand geographic patterns and relationships. With technological advancements, GIS applications have become more sophisticated and accessible. 

The advancements in GIS technology have numerous practical applications. For example, in disaster management, GIS can help predict and visualize the impact of natural disasters, enabling better preparedness and response. In urban planning, GIS assists in designing efficient transportation systems, optimizing land use, and improving infrastructure. Environmental monitoring also benefits from GIS by tracking changes in ecosystems and aiding in conservation efforts. These applications highlight how GIS, powered by advanced technology, is breaking geographical barriers and solving complex problems worldwide.

  • Telecommunication Advancements

The evolution of telecommunications has been remarkable, transitioning from traditional landlines to modern internet-based communication systems. High-speed internet and mobile networks have significantly bridged distances, making it possible to communicate instantly with anyone, anywhere. These advancements have had a profound impact on various aspects of life, including remote work, telemedicine, and virtual meetings. For instance, professionals can now collaborate with colleagues across the globe without the need for physical travel. This has not only increased productivity but also reduced costs and environmental impact associated with business travel.

One of the most exciting developments in telecommunications is the advent of 5G technology. 5G offers faster data speeds, lower latency, and more reliable connections, further enhancing global connectivity. With 5G, activities such as high-definition video conferencing, real-time data sharing, and remote control of devices become more efficient and accessible. 

  • E-commerce and Global Trade

E-commerce has transformed global trade, allowing businesses to reach customers worldwide with ease. Technological advancements have enabled the creation of online platforms where products and services can be bought and sold across borders, which has opened up new opportunities for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) to enter international markets. By leveraging e-commerce, businesses can expand their reach, increase sales, and build a global customer base without the need for physical stores. Examples of successful e-commerce platforms, such as Amazon and Alibaba, illustrate the vast potential of this technology in facilitating global trade.

In addition to online platforms, technology has also improved logistics and supply chain management, which are crucial for international trade. Innovations such as automated warehousing, real-time tracking systems, and data analytics have streamlined operations, making it easier to manage cross-border shipments. These advancements ensure that products are delivered quickly and efficiently, enhancing customer satisfaction and trust. 

  •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R)

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) are reshaping how we interact with the world by creating immersive experiences that transcend geographical barriers. VR technology allows users to enter a computer-generated environment, providing a sense of presence in a different location. This is particularly useful in fields like virtual tourism, where people can explore distant places without leaving their homes. Museums, historical sites, and natural wonders can be visited virtually, offering educational and recreational experiences that were once limited by physical distance. Additionally, VR is being used in remote training and education, enabling students and professionals to engage in interactive learning experiences regardless of their location.

Augmented Reality (AR), on the other hand, overlays digital information onto the real world, enhancing our interaction with our surroundings. AR applications are being used in navigation, providing real-time directions and information about landmarks. In industries like construction and maintenance, AR can assist workers by displaying critical data and instructions directly in their field of view, reducing errors and improving efficiency. 

  • Online Education and Learning Platforms

The rise of online education has been a game-changer in democratizing knowledge and breaking down geographical barriers. With the proliferation of online learning platforms, high-quality education is now accessible to anyone with an internet connection. Platforms like Coursera, edX, and Khan Academy offer a wide range of courses from leading universities and institutions around the world. It has opened up opportunities for individuals in remote or underserved areas to access the same educational resources as those in major cities. Online education provides the flexibility to learn at one’s own pace, accommodating different schedules and learning styles, making it an attractive option for lifelong learners and working professionals.

The benefits of online education extend beyond accessibility. Online courses often include interactive elements such as discussion forums, group projects, and live sessions, enhancing engagement and collaboration.

  • Social Media and Global Communities

Social media platforms have transformed how we connect with others, creating global communities that transcend geographical boundaries. Platforms like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, and LinkedIn allow people to communicate and share information instantly, regardless of where they are in the world. Social media has played a significant role in fostering global awareness and understanding, enabling users to engage with diverse perspectives and cultures. It has also been a powerful tool for social movements, allowing people to mobilize and advocate for causes on a global scale. Campaigns and movements that start in one part of the world can quickly gain international support and visibility, driving social change and raising awareness about critical issues.

In addition to fostering global awareness, social media has facilitated collaboration and innovation. Professionals and enthusiasts in various fields can connect and share knowledge, leading to the development of new ideas and solutions. For example, online communities of scientists, artists, and entrepreneurs regularly exchange insights and collaborate on projects, breaking down the barriers that once limited such interactions.
